    I hired an x-trail in Tasmania last year, did a couple thousand k’s on road and it was better than I expected, being a manual diesel guy. Took a track down to a beach, the kind that gets hairier as you go till it’s too late to turn back. The last hundred metres down to the beach was hard sand covered clay, with the kind of articulating mounds you see at a demo. Wife was freaking out about getting stuck in the sand. The little x-trail cruised straight up those articulations piece of cake two wheel teetering, where my hilux probably would have needed a lot more momentum. I was impressed for what it is
